Data from Agreste, the statistical service of France's Ministry of Agriculture, reveals a decrease in plantings of soft wheat, durum wheat, and triticale for the 2022 season, with only squash seedlings showing an increase. The total winter grain sole is expected to slightly decrease by 0.4% from the previous year. Additionally, the report updates the 2021 harvest data, showing a revision in corn production to 15.4 million tonnes due to a change in crop type, and an increase in beet production and yield of ware and half-season potatoes.
